Transaction 987954b45e2510571e1639d21ba9cdcc6a58f62679b8cded9709bae37f58980a
1 Input
1 Output
-
987954b45e2510571e1639d21ba9cdcc6a58f62679b8cded9709bae37f58980a:0
- value
- 3018707
- script pubkey
- OP_0 OP_PUSHBYTES_32 dbf5ebb8fe9da385513f26a764bb387d29c2e23d6daac5e3447af3a1528c7d45
- address
- bc1qm067hw87nk3c25fly6nkfwec055u9c3adk4vtc6y0te6z55v04zsmw3pjt